Blind source separation (BSS) is a process of separating and recovering a relatively independent target source signal from the observed multi-source mixed signal including interference and target. BSS uses the difference between the target echo signal and the interference signal to separate the echo signal from the interference signal, which can suppress the influence of the interference signal on the target echo, and can also extract the interference signal from the mixed signal. We can take more effective anti-interference measures by analyzing interference signals. In this paper, the blind source separation (BSS) method based on reciprocal decomposition is used to transform the mixed matrix and unmixing matrix estimation problem into the space-time parameter estimation problem of multi-source signals. Through the adaptive estimation of the space-time parameters of the source signal, the steering vector and its dual vector corresponding to the direction of the incoming wave are obtained, and the unmixing matrix is directly constructed to realize the effective decomposition of the signal.
